Hydration vs. Moisture: What Your Skin Needs

To understand how water affects your skin, let's talk about two words that sound alike but are different: hydration and moisture.

  • Hydration is about the water inside your skin cells. Think of your skin like a plump grape when it's well-hydrated. It looks full, soft, and smooth. You can help hydrate your skin by drinking plenty of clean water and eating foods that have a lot of water.
  • Moisture is about the natural oils on top of your skin. These oils act like a protective blanket. They lock in the water (hydration) and stop it from drying out. Lotions and creams add more moisture to this layer.

For truly glowing skin, you need both hydration and moisture. But if your water takes away your natural oils or leaves behind tiny mineral bits, even the best beauty products can't do their job well.

Your Skin's Protective Shield

Your skin has a very important outer layer. Think of it like a strong brick wall. The "bricks" are your skin cells, and the "mortar" is a mix of natural fats and oils. This wall is your body's first line of defense!

A strong skin wall does two main jobs:

1. Keeps the good stuff in: It holds onto water and helpful nutrients.

2. Keeps the bad stuff out: It stops germs, dirt, and things that might irritate your skin from getting in.

When this skin wall gets weak, your skin becomes open to problems. It can get dry, sensitive, irritated, and might even show signs of aging faster. Many things can hurt your skin's wall, but one big reason is the water you use every day.

Hard Water: A Hidden Problem for Your Skin

Have you ever felt your skin tight and dry after a shower? Or noticed your hair looks dull, no matter what shampoo you use? The problem could be hard water.

Hard water has a lot of dissolved minerals, like calcium and magnesium. Soft water, on the other hand, has very few of these minerals. Even though hard water is safe to drink, it can be tough on your skin and hair.

The minerals in hard water mix with your soaps, cleansers, and shampoos. This creates a thin, soapy film that's hard to rinse off. This film can:

  • Clog your pores: Leading to pimples and breakouts.
  • Strip your skin's natural oils: Making your skin dry and itchy.

Over time, this mineral buildup can break down your skin's protective wall. This leads to issues like:

  • Dry, flaky skin
  • Skin that easily gets red or sensitive
  • More breakouts and blackheads
  • Hair that looks dull and feels brittle
